The HEAD Nano Ti Spector 2.0 is a 195g squash racket featuring advanced Nano Titanium technology for enhanced power and maneuverability. Its 14x19 synthetic gut string pattern offers superior playability, while the 75.2in² head size and head-light balance enable quick reaction shots. Designed for beginners seeking professional-grade performance, it combines lightweight durability with sleek aesthetics, making it a top choice for aspiring squash players.

Good as a starter racquet but you'll need to upgrade quite quickly
I took up squash and bought this racquet, mainly because of the low cost and relatively good reviews. The racquet is light, comes with a head protector and looks fairly good. It is well made and to be fair plays very well for a beginner. I found I outgrew it quite quickly and when I borrowed a friend's racquet after a month or two of lessons I really noticed the difference. I would recommend this for any beginner, especially if you're just getting in to squash and aren't sure if you're going to like it or not (you will squash is legit, unreal). As a cheap racquet that will 'serve' (pardon the pun) you well when you're starting but you will need to upgrade it fairly quickly if you're playing regularly. All round solid base level beginner racquet at an amazing price.

It is much better than my first impression
I bought this to act as a back up for my Prince EX03 and that's how it has remained. It is a good training racket, as it is a little too heavy for games which means that you are more likely to pull a shoulder muscle. That said, I have used it a lot for warming up and doing routines, so it has been a good buy. If I broke it, I'd buy another. Update now that I've been using this for a few months. I have switched my opinion. I found that as I have improved my squash game, it has become my favourite raquet. It is slightly heavier, but it is much better for accuracy or touch shots. I guess I'm fitter now, and I don't notice the extra weight that was evident over the Prince EX03. I find it more accurate for overhead and volley shots, so great for my league matches. I initially gave this 4 stars, but I have uprated to 5 stars. It has also withstood plenty of abuse.

Good, but...
The racket is suitable for beginners or maybe even a bit more. I used the racket for 2 months at around 4 days a week. The strings broke after those 2 months. I played quite much so I can understand that. The racket is quite heavy compared to other "advanced" rackets that weight around 120-140 grams. But then again, you would need to at least pay double than what you will pay for this racket. I am now going to buy a higher end racket but if you don't play that often and are a beginner then I would totally recommend it because of the low price. If you are new to squash and are not planning on playing very often, this is a good choice. If you already play, play regularly and want to improve your game; buy another one. Again, as this racket weights more than the high-end rackets it gives you a good training. So you will feel a difference when you change to a better racket. Finally, if you just play for fun from time to time and don't plan to train regularly or for a team then this is a very good racket taking the price into account.
